在当前的电商环境中,数据是驱动业务决策的关键要素。对于电商平台上的商家和数据分析师而言,能够高效、准确地抓取淘宝、拼多多等平台的商品数据,对于市场趋势分析、竞品监测、商品优化等方面都具有重要意义。本文将围绕免费API工具在淘宝、拼多多商品数据抓取方案上的对比展开深入讨论,从数据抓取能力、易用性、安全性、功能丰富度等多个维度进行分析,旨在为用户提供有价值的参考。
一、免费API工具概述
免费API工具在电商数据抓取领域扮演着重要角色。这些工具通常提供了一系列接口,允许开发者通过编程方式访问电商平台上的商品数据。相较于爬虫技术,API工具具有更高的稳定性、更低的门槛和更好的合规性。然而,免费API工具在功能、数据量和访问频率等方面往往存在一定的限制。因此,在选择和使用这些工具时,需要综合考虑业务需求、数据质量、易用性等因素。
二、淘宝商品数据抓取方案
1. 淘宝开放平台API介绍
淘宝开放平台是阿里巴巴集团旗下的一个开放平台,为开发者提供了丰富的API接口,涵盖了商品搜索、详情查询、交易记录等多个方面。对于商品数据抓取而言,淘宝开放平台提供了如“taobao.tbk.item.get”等接口,这些接口能够返回包括商品标题、价格、销量、评价、优惠券信息等在内的详细信息。
2. 免费API工具在淘宝数据抓取中的应用
在淘宝商品数据抓取中,免费API工具主要依赖于淘宝开放平台提供的接口。这些工具通常封装了接口调用、数据解析等复杂逻辑,为开发者提供了简单易用的接口。以下是几个免费API工具在淘宝数据抓取中的应用案例:
- 数据聚合平台:一些数据聚合平台提供了基于淘宝开放平台的免费API接口,允许用户查询商品信息。这些平台通常对接口调用频率和数据量进行了一定的限制,但足以满足一般的数据抓取需求。
- 开发者社区工具:在开发者社区中,一些热心的开发者会分享自己封装的API调用工具,这些工具通常具有更加灵活的配置选项和更高的定制化能力。然而,由于这些工具并非官方提供,因此在稳定性和安全性方面可能存在一定风险。
- 第三方数据服务:一些第三方数据服务公司也提供了基于淘宝开放平台的免费API接口服务,这些服务通常具有一定的数据分析和处理能力,能够为用户提供更加全面的数据支持。
3. 数据抓取流程与注意事项
在使用免费API工具抓取淘宝商品数据时,需要遵循一定的流程和注意事项:
- 注册与认证:首先,开发者需要在淘宝开放平台注册账号并完成认证流程。在认证过程中,需要提供个人或企业的相关信息以证明身份和资质。
- 接口选择与配置:完成认证后,开发者可以在淘宝开放平台选择所需的API接口并进行配置。在配置过程中,需要设置接口调用的参数、权限等选项以确保数据的准确性和安全性。
- 数据抓取与解析:通过调用配置好的API接口,开发者可以获取到商品数据的JSON或XML格式响应。接下来,需要对响应数据进行解析和处理以提取出所需的信息。
- 数据清洗与整合:抓取到的原始数据往往需要进行清洗和整合工作以去除重复、无效或异常数据,并将不同来源的数据整合到一个统一的数据库中。
- 注意事项:在使用免费API工具时,需要注意接口调用频率的限制、数据量的限制以及数据的安全性和隐私保护问题。此外,还需要遵守淘宝开放平台的使用规定和法律法规要求。
三、拼多多商品数据抓取方案
1. 拼多多开放平台API介绍
拼多多开放平台是拼多多为开发者提供的一个开放平台,旨在帮助开发者快速接入拼多多的数据和服务。对于商品数据抓取而言,拼多多开放平台提供了如“pinduoduo.item_get”等接口,这些接口能够返回包括商品标题、价格、库存、销量、评价等在内的详细信息。与淘宝开放平台类似,拼多多开放平台也提供了详细的接口文档和示例代码以支持开发者的接入和使用。
2. 免费API工具在拼多多数据抓取中的应用
在拼多多商品数据抓取中,免费API工具同样发挥着重要作用。这些工具通常基于拼多多开放平台提供的接口进行封装和扩展,为开发者提供了更加便捷的数据抓取方式。以下是几个免费API工具在拼多多数据抓取中的应用案例:
- 官方SDK:拼多多开放平台提供了官方的SDK工具包,这些工具包封装了接口调用的底层逻辑和数据解析等功能,为开发者提供了更加高效的数据抓取方式。开发者可以通过下载和安装SDK工具包来快速接入拼多多的数据服务。
- 开源项目:在GitHub等开源社区中,一些开发者会分享自己封装的拼多多API调用工具。这些工具通常具有更加灵活的配置选项和更高的定制化能力,能够满足开发者多样化的需求。然而,由于这些工具并非官方提供,因此在稳定性和安全性方面可能需要进行额外的评估和测试。
- 第三方数据服务:与淘宝类似,一些第三方数据服务公司也提供了基于拼多多开放平台的免费API接口服务。这些服务通常具有一定的数据分析和处理能力,能够为用户提供更加全面的数据支持。
3. 数据抓取流程与注意事项
在使用免费API工具抓取拼多多商品数据时,同样需要遵循一定的流程和注意事项:
- 注册与认证:开发者需要在拼多多开放平台注册账号并完成认证流程。在认证过程中,需要提供个人或企业的相关信息以证明身份和资质。同时,还需要遵守拼多多开放平台的使用规定和法律法规要求。
- 接口选择与配置:完成认证后,开发者可以在拼多多开放平台选择所需的API接口并进行配置。在配置过程中,需要设置接口调用的参数、权限等选项以确保数据的准确性和安全性。与淘宝类似,拼多多开放平台也提供了详细的接口文档和示例代码以支持开发者的接入和使用。
- 数据抓取与解析:通过调用配置好的API接口,开发者可以获取到商品数据的JSON或XML格式响应。接下来,需要对响应数据进行解析和处理以提取出所需的信息。在解析过程中,需要注意数据的结构和格式以确保数据的正确性和完整性。
- 数据清洗与整合:与淘宝类似,抓取到的原始数据同样需要进行清洗和整合工作以去除重复、无效或异常数据,并将不同来源的数据整合到一个统一的数据库中。这一步骤对于后续的数据分析和挖掘至关重要。
- 注意事项:在使用免费API工具时,同样需要注意接口调用频率的限制、数据量的限制以及数据的安全性和隐私保护问题。此外,还需要遵守拼多多开放平台的使用规定和法律法规要求,确保数据的合法性和合规性。